More about the book
Set during a banquet in ancient Athens, a group of philosophers engages in lively discussions and friendly debates, showcasing their views on love and virtue. Socrates, featured among the characters, serves as a focal point for differing interpretations of his philosophy, sparking debate on whether Plato's portrayal is a tribute or a critique. The work explores themes of friendship, love, and the nature of knowledge, reflecting the complexities of philosophical thought in a vibrant social setting.
